- What is OCR and why do I need it for PDFs?
- OCR (Optical Character Recognition) extracts text from scanned documents or image-based PDFs. Scanned PDFs look like documents but are actually just images — OCR makes their text searchable and copyable.

- How accurate is PDFBro's OCR?
- Accuracy depends on the scan quality. Clear, high-resolution scans of typed text typically achieve 95%+ accuracy. Handwriting and low-quality scans have lower accuracy.
